Price so far:
HD diffs and purchase of rig- $134
Axial aluminum wheel hexes $6
Redcat aluminum c hubs $16
Rc4wd comp tires $60

Total $216

Way cheaper than anything else you will get and these things I replaced were the things that have broke over the progression of my other one.

Two more test runs a success. With the comp tires really wrinkle up they load down the motor to the point it won't turn. This is good amd bad. This shows me the limits without anything breaking. A stronger motor would star snapping shafts. If I stayed in it I'd smoke the motor. So good and bad. It's capabilities are excellent though. It comes with four preload spacers for the shocks. I moved all four to the rear first thing after I got it but I found the chassis will twist and the rear will drive towards one side or another in stead of pushing up the rocks. I got 2 more of the spacers from my first e10 and added them in. So I'm at 3 on each rear shock. It will lift the other side tire without too much chassis twist now. This helps force it forwards and it really made a difference. The only thing I want now is more weight over the front axle. It has the grip to climb more but lifts the front end.
